The purpose of the Private Equity Product Support Group is to act as the interface between the funds' investment professionals, investors, and external contacts, such as accounting outsource providers, auditors, tax professionals, and third party sellers, etc. for private equity funds. The Private Equity Product Support Group and this position concentrate on supporting all financial reporting for private equity funds. The Product Support Group focuses on adding value by resolving issues and providing product oversight and coordination, rather than the performance of day-to-day operational tasks and controls.  Currently the Group provides this service for three private equity programs consisting of 30 funds, in aggregate, which are private equity fund of funds with direct private equity investments, two programs consisting of three funds which are solely direct private equity investments and two funds that are solely a fund of funds. The Associate will primarily be responsible for certain BlackRock funds that will be structured like a private equity fund with regard to capital calls. The funds' investors are high net worth retail clients and institutional clients, including offshore clients. This Associate position reports directly to a Director/Vice President. Besides this position, the group currently consists of a Director (department head), another Director, an Administrative Assistant, a part time student intern, five other Assistant Vice Presidents/Associates, three Accounting Vice Presidents, a tax specialist (VP) and a Communication Group made up of a VP with 3 additional staff members. Primary Job Responsibilities: Preparation of personalized capital statements; Responsible for monitoring the treasury function (forecasting, budgeting, borrowing, etc.); Interface with clients to answer ad hoc financial and tax questions, as well as resolve miscellaneous issues; Prepare loan compliance reporting; Prepare quarterly and annual financial statements and year end audits; Responsible for preparation of monthly and quarterly management reporting, including pricing of NAVs. Job Requirements: Bachelors degree in Accounting preferred, with at least 5 years related experience; Financial and management reporting experience and partnership accounting experience, a MUST; Partnership tax experience, a plus; Minimum 1 year PRIVATE EQUITY FUND accounting experience strongly preferred; The ability to read, understand and follow complex partnership agreements and offering materials; CPA license (or in process); Excellent organizational and communication skills (both written and oral); Proficiency in Microsoft Excel; Knowledge of Microsoft Word; 2-3 years of public accounting experience a plus; Ability to prioritize and juggle workload, strong admin/problem solving skills with attention to detail; Always needs to be aware of deadlines and effectively plan to ensure that all are met; Required to be a self-starter, work independently and require little supervision; Ability to maintain good working relationships with all contacts.
